10690324
0xec13863fd40e3233d1a249809d7c95a6e0045086b2c513335dd41f3b6e8268c0
Transactions0
Height10690324
Confirmations129079
Timestamp10 days 23 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x7d66a98a2879dc91
Bits
Difficulty0x2d6664cf